. Identify the converse of the conditional statement. Determine the truth values of the original conditional and its converse. I

f an angle is a right angle, then its measure is 90.
A.

If the measure of an angle is 90, then it is a right angle.
Original: true
Converse: true





B.

If an angle is not a right angle, then its measure is not 90.
Original: true
Converse: true





C.

If an angle is not a right angle, then its measure is 90.
Original: true
Converse: false





D.

The answer should be A which is:
<span>
If the measure of an angle is 90, then it is a right angle.
Original: true
Converse: true

</span><span>p is angel is right
</span><span> q is its measure is 90
</span><span>the statement is p then q so the converse is q then p </span>

A triangle has two angles that measure 18.6 degrees and 113.4 degrees respectively. what is the measure of the third angle?
spin [16.1K]

Answer:

x = 48

Step-by-step explanation:

18.6 + 113.4 + x = 180

132 + x = 180

x = 180 - 132

x = 48
